📝 Color Information for #EECA7C

The hexadecimal color code #EECA7C represents a light shade in the orange family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 238 red, 202 green, and 124 blue, which translates to approximately 93% red, 79% green, and 49%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#EECA7C has a hue of 41 degrees, a saturation level of 77%, and a lightness value of 71%. The hue angle of 41° places this color firmly in the orange sp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 41°, saturation of 48%, and brightness/value of 93%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#EECA7C would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 15% magenta, 48% yellow, and 7% black. The closest web-safe color is #FFCC66,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. As a lighter shade, it's excellent for backgrounds, negative space, and creating a sense of openness in designs. The high saturation makes this color vibrant and attention-grabbing, ideal for call-to-action buttons, highlights, and accent elements. When pairing #EECA7C with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 221°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 15649404,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#EECA7C? +

The approximate CMYK value of #EECA7C is C:0% M:15% Y:48% K:7%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
